Kogi Council Chairman collapses, dies hours to governorship election

Published By: Michael Adesina

By Michael Adeshina

The All Progressives Congress in Kogi was thrown into mourning on Friday as the Chairman of Lokoja Local Government Council, Hon. Muhammed Danasabe, suddenly passed away.

The shocking news hit the APC camp with just few hours to the governorship election.

Muhammed, who participated in a lot of campaign activities, was taken to the hospital after he collapsed in his home late on Thursday.

At around 4:30am in the morning, a hospital in the state capital of Lokoja confirmed his death.

A family source said he was rushed to Shifa Hospital, Lokoja, after he slumped in the house at the late hours of Thursday.

“Doctors confirmed him clinically dead around 4.30am on Friday,” the source stated.

He will be buried at the Unguwan Kura Muslim cemetery after the Juma’at prayer on Friday.

The Public Relation Officer (PRO) of the All Progressives Congress (APC) in Lokoja, Talba Lakwaja, also confirmed the incident.

“This is to notify the general public that the remains of the Lokoja Local Government Council Chairman, Hon. Mohammed Dasebe Mohammed, will be buried at Anguwan Kura burial ground 2pm immediately after jummat prayer. The body will depart his family house at cantonment to Lokoja Central Mosque by 1:30pm,” Talba stated.
